Re: Mis-behaving and running lean 700 1987

It may be simple, check large rubber boot between airbox / throttle body.

mine was ripped and sucking junk in, I had erratic idle and steering wheel shake at idle. large hole on under side was only found after removal and inspection. replacement from Volvo is plastic not rubber and 1 piece VS 2 piece on car from factory.
